How to test Wi-Fi speed
- Confirm the device is connected to the Wi-Fi network you want to test and turn off cellular fallback if necessary.
- Pause downloads, cloud backups, video streams, and other heavy traffic.
- Run the internet speed test in the room where the problem normally occurs.
- Repeat the test two more times and note the middle result.
- Move close to the router and repeat with the same device.
What the comparison tells you
If the Wi-Fi speed test improves substantially near the router, the internet connection reaching the router may be healthy while wireless coverage, interference, or band selection is the problem. If performance remains poor near the router, compare with wired Ethernet where possible. A slow wired result makes the modem, router, provider, or broadband plan more likely.
Wi-Fi speed is not Wi-Fi signal strength
A Wi-Fi signal test measures radio strength, while a Wi-Fi bandwidth test measures data transfer through the wireless link and the internet path. Strong signal does not guarantee high speed: congestion, an older Wi-Fi standard, router load, channel width, and upstream broadband can still limit performance. The SpeedTest browser test measures end-to-end internet performance, not raw radio signal strength.
Why Wi-Fi speed changes by room
- Distance and walls: signal weakens as it travels, especially through dense materials.
- Frequency band: 5 GHz and 6 GHz usually offer more nearby capacity, while 2.4 GHz reaches farther but is often busier.
- Interference: neighboring networks and household electronics can compete for airtime.
- Device capability: the phone, computer, and router must support compatible Wi-Fi standards and channel widths.
- Mesh backhaul: a mesh node with a weak connection to the main router can repeat a poor link.
What is a good Wi-Fi speed?
“Good” depends on the activity and how many devices share the connection. HD video often needs roughly 5–10 Mbps per stream and 4K video often needs 25 Mbps or more. Video calls need stable upload as well as download. Online games usually use modest bandwidth but respond best to low, stable latency. Compare the result with the speed delivered near the router and with what your broadband plan can provide.
When a Wi-Fi test looks unstable
Large swings between repeated tests can indicate interference, contention, automatic band switching, background traffic, or a congested internet route.
